Brookville Seminary Valley, Alexandria, VA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Brookville Seminary Valley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brookville Seminary Valley 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,645 | $1,650 | $3,400 |
| Brookville Seminary Valley 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,516 | $2,700 | $4,400 |
| Brookville Seminary Valley 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,378 | $3,100 | $5,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Brookville Seminary Valley
What type of rentals are currently available in Brookville Seminary Valley?
There are currently 181 Apartments for Rent in Brookville Seminary Valley, VA with pricing that ranges from $1,112 to $11,963. There are also 113 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Brookville Seminary Valley ranging from $1,150 to $5,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Brookville Seminary Valley?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Brookville Seminary Valley ranges from $1,150 to $5,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,734.
